Newmont Mining Corporation (NEM) is leading gold exploration and production Company included in the S&P 500 index. The Company operates on 5 continents, with significant exploration assets and operations held in the United States, Australia, Peru, Indonesia, Ghana, Canada, Bolivia, New Zealand and Mexico. As at December 31, 2007, the Company’s total gold reserves (both proven and probable) amounted to 86.5 million equity ounces, with its total global land position of around 42,680 square miles (110,550 square kilometers).

Newmont Takes 6.7% Stake in Paladin


The world's second largest gold producer, Newmont Mining Corporation (ASX:NEM), has taken a 6.7 percent stake in uranium miner Paladin Energy (ASX:PDN), after completing the takeover of Canada's Fronteer Gold. Newmont rose $0.08 to $57.32 per share and gained 52.1 million shares in Paladin, according to a holders' notice on Wednesday.

Australian Gold Mines 2010


Australian Gold production is set to reach $10 billion in 2010 as output is increased at a time of historically high gold prices. In 2009, Australia produced 227 tonnes (or 7.3 million ounces) of Gold (increase of 3 percent on 2008). At current gold prices of $1250 for an ounce of Gold, the Australian gold output of 2009 would have fetched $9 billion. With the high gold prices, this precious metal is set to be Australia's third biggest export earner after iron ore and coking coal.
